Part 2: Material Selection – Balancing Aesthetics and Durability

The choice of materials is crucial for both the aesthetic appeal and the durability of the product. The target audience values both _modern aesthetics_ and _practicality_, meaning the materials must meet stringent quality criteria.

Several materials are under consideration for this 3D model:

* _Bamboo:_ A sustainable and aesthetically pleasing option, bamboo offers excellent durability and is naturally resistant to bacteria. Its warm tone aligns perfectly with the _modern minimalist aesthetic_. However, bamboo's susceptibility to water damage needs careful consideration, requiring a design that incorporates appropriate sealing and water-resistant features.

* _Hardwood (e.g., Walnut, Maple):_ These premium hardwoods offer exceptional durability, beautiful grain patterns, and a luxurious feel. They can be easily shaped and finished to achieve the desired _modern aesthetic_. However, hardwood is more expensive than bamboo and requires more careful maintenance.

* _High-Density Polyethylene (HDPE):_ This plastic material is a robust and durable alternative, offering excellent resistance to water and bacteria. Its affordability makes it a viable option, but achieving a sleek, _modern aesthetic_ with HDPE might require sophisticated molding techniques and potentially a surface treatment.

* _Stainless Steel:_ For components like the integrated utensil or parts of the seasoning bottle mechanism, stainless steel offers exceptional hygiene and durability. Its _modern and sleek appearance_ complements the overall design.

The final material selection will be based on a thorough cost-benefit analysis, considering factors such as sustainability, durability, manufacturing costs, and the desired aesthetic outcome. Extensive _prototyping_ and testing will be crucial in determining the optimal material combination.

Part 4: 3D Modeling and Manufacturing Considerations

The 3D model will be developed using industry-standard software like _SolidWorks_ or _Fusion 360_. This allows for precise design, detailed rendering, and simulations to test functionality and ergonomics before prototyping. The model will need to incorporate details such as tolerances, material specifications, and assembly instructions for efficient manufacturing.

Several manufacturing processes are being considered:

* _Injection Molding (for plastic components):_ This is a cost-effective method for mass production of plastic components, allowing for complex shapes and high precision.

* _CNC Machining (for wood components):_ This method is ideal for producing high-quality wood components with intricate details.

* _Casting (for metal components):_ Casting is suitable for producing the metal parts of the seasoning bottle mechanism or the integrated utensil if made of stainless steel.

The selection of the optimal manufacturing process will depend on the chosen materials and the desired production volume.
